Hi everyone! We’re a group of Penn State students working on an amazing service project through our Creativity & Innovation in Business course. Our mission is to collect pet food for the wonderful animals at Centre County PAWS, a local non-profit animal shelter near campus.

Instead of collecting physical cans, we’re using this GoFundMe to raise funds that will go directly toward buying food for the shelter’s cats and dogs. Every dollar counts and every donation helps us get closer to our team goal!

Why We’re Doing This:
• Centre County PAWS is home to many homeless animals who need our help.
• Due to limited resources, they rely heavily on donations to care for the dogs and cats they rescue.

How Your Donation Helps:

All money donated will be used to purchase cans and bags of dog and cat food for PAWS. Here’s how we convert donations:
• $0.86 = 1 can of dog food
• $0.52 = 1 can of cat food

So, even a small gift of $5 could feed a hungry animal for several days!
